Empire of Algorithms: How AI is Redrawing the Map of Power Among Nations

The next world war won't be fought with tanks or missiles-it will be fought with algorithms. As artificial intelligence spreads into finance, defense, and governance, it is quietly reshaping the global balance of power. The nations that control code, data, and chips will decide the winners and losers of the 21st century, leaving others trapped in dependence.

This book reveals how AI geopolitics has become the defining contest of our age, from the chip wars and compute power race between the U.S. and China to the rise of data colonialism and sovereignty struggles in smaller states. It shows how algorithms are already weaponized for disinformation, economic coercion, and surveillance-altering elections, shaping beliefs, and challenging what it means to govern.

Drawing on history, international strategy, and cutting-edge technology debates, it offers a framework to understand why AI functions like a silent bomb: an arsenal that doesn't explode but manipulates markets, societies, and even identities. For policymakers, business leaders, and globally minded readers, it explains not just how technology works, but how it redistributes power.

Inside, you'll discover: - Why algorithmic statecraft is replacing traditional diplomacy; - How generative AI policy and governance debates decide who leads and who follows; - What computational sovereignty frameworks reveal about the future of independence; - How disinformation and deepfakes in geopolitics will challenge democracies and empower authoritarian states

By the final page, you'll have a new lens to read the headlines, anticipate global shifts, and understand the hidden mechanics of a future already unfolding. Clear, urgent, and provocative, this book equips you with the insight to see how power itself is being rewritten by artificial intelligence.

About the Author

Arden Hale is a writer and strategist who studies how emerging technologies reorder power between states, markets, and citizens. For more than a decade, Hale has worked at the intersection of AI policy, semiconductor supply chains, and digital governance, translating complex research into decision-ready insights for leaders in business and public life. Hale's work blends historical perspective with systems thinking and a practical question that runs through every page: who gains when code becomes law? Empire of Algorithms continues this inquiry-offering a clear, grounded framework for readers who want to understand, and responsibly shape, the rules of the coming order.
